Grilled Cilantro-Lime Chicken Skewers
Juicy chicken marinated in a zesty cilantro-lime blend, grilled to perfection on skewers for a flavorful and satisfying meal. Ingredients
- 1 lb, cut into 1-inch cubes boneless skinless chicken thighs
- 1/2 cup chopped fresh cilantro
- 3 tbsp lime juice
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 3, minced garlic cloves
- 1 tsp ground cumin
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
- 6, soaked in water for 30 minutes wooden skewers

Instructions
- Step 1: In a bowl, whisk together 1/2 cup chopped fresh cilantro, 3 tbsp lime juice, 2 tbsp olive oil, 3 minced garlic cloves, 1 tsp ground cumin, 1 tsp salt, and 1/2 tsp black pepper to create the marinade.
- Step 2: Add 1 lb cubed boneless skinless chicken thighs to the marinade, tossing to coat evenly.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our or up to 4 hours.
- Step 3: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at. Thread marinated chicken cubes onto 6 soaked wooden skewers.
- Step 4: Grill skewers for 4-5 minutes per side, turning once, until chicken is cooked through and has nice grill marks. Let rest for 5 minutes before serving.

How do I store leftover Grilled Cilantro-Lime Chicken Skewers?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ep fresh cilantro from drying out.

How do I scale Grilled Cilantro-Lime Chicken Skewers for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
